RateSentry checks hotel rate parity across the Velmora and Duskinn booking feeds. Your tasks: maintain the scrapers, keep the mismatch classifier above 95% precision, and triage parity alerts for the Harrowgate pilot properties. Deploys go through the Copperline pipeline; never push to prod directly. Read the scraper etiquette doc before touching feed adapters — rate limits are contractual. Access to the credentials vault is granted on day one, and the recovery passphrase for it is listed immediately below.

unlock words, yawig-kagef: gordor-holvan-ulaael-pramir-ulaiel-tamdor

ALERT: tailctl session backlog exceeded

This fires when tailctl, our internal CLI for live log tailing, has more than 200 queued sessions on the Harrowgate cluster. It usually means a stuck consumer holding connections open. Do not restart the broker first; identify and kill the stale sessions. Step-by-step instructions for new team members are on the page below.

dashboard of bafof-hafog = https://confluence.lumiclabs.internal/display/browse/display/6a09a20a

## Build Provenance: TilePress Cache Layer

Every TilePress cache build is stamped at compile time. Provenance covers the renderer commit, the tile schema version, and the cache eviction config. New hires: never deploy an unstamped artifact; the rollout gate will reject it anyway. To verify a running node, query the /provenance endpoint and compare against the release manifest. The current stamped token is below.

build token for kagaf-hahof: htk14_9d3d4d26d7d8de

Unit costs range within four percent of current pricing; qualification testing would take roughly ten weeks. Sales leads should note that customer commitments through next quarter are protected under existing stock. We recommend proceeding with Merrin as primary candidate, pending quality audit. The confidential plan underpinning this recommendation appears below.

management briefing: Project Ulavan slips by two quarters because of the staffing delay.

**Runbook: ShrinkRay CLI release**

Plugin authors: before publishing against a new ShrinkRay release, verify the batch-resize binary's signature or your plugin loader will refuse it. We rotate roughly quarterly, so don't hardcode old fingerprints. Grab the tarball, run the verify subcommand, and check it against the current release key shown here.

rollout seal: bky4_x7Gc